Autor Zpráva
tomas657
Profil
Zdravím, mám otázku, dá sa nejakým spôsobom vypísať obsah php súboru (prípona php, súbor obsahuje php scripty) pomocou funkcie fopen (resp. fread) alebo nejakou inou funkciou bez toho, aby sa script spustil, ale sa len klasicky zobrazil jeho obsah v prehliadači ako napr. v notepade? Skúšal som to na hostingu, ale zobrazila sa len prázdna stránka...
fajzen
Profil
readfile
file_get_contents
tomas657
Profil
čo ak chcem obsah súboru zobraziť v textarea? nebude to fungovať, ak zobrazovaný súbor obsahuje v sebe ukončenie textarea, čiže sa zobrazí iba po to miesto, kde je </textarea>.. ako zariadiť aby sa zobrazil celý obsah súboru, dal sa pritom editovať a následne uložiť (s tým by nemal byť problém)..
Bubák
Profil
Co tak místo <textarea> použít <div>
<div contenteditable='true'>Obsah, který je možné přímo upravovat</div>

http://priklady.str4wberry.cz/contenteditable/
tomas657
Profil
[#4]
no ale tak vznikne podobný problém... ak zobrazovaný súbor obsahuje </div>, tak sa celé <div contenteditable='true'> ukončí a zvyšok obsahu súboru sa buď nevypíše alebo sa vypíše až mimo contenteditable
fajzen
Profil
tak použi file_get_contents a pred vypísaním textu použi ešte htmlspecialchars, tým by sa malo zabrániť tomu, čo si hovoril... pri spätnom zápise do súboru budeš musieť pravdepodobne použiť htmlspecialchars_decode (funguje až od PHP 5.1)
dasd
Profil *
[img]Odkaz[/img]

Vaše odpověď


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m: